window.onload = function() { var canvas = document.getElementById("canvas"); var obj = canvas.getContext('2d ...
DEMO地址:http: codepen.io jonechen pen eZpgWd 不废话,直接上DEMO了,这个效果实现起来并不复杂,但是麻雀随小,五脏俱全,主要涉及到的知识点有: canvas的基本绘图 js各个事件的监听 js动画 三角函数结合js在canvas中的基本应用 ...
2016-03-04 21:05 0 3544 推荐指数:
window.onload = function() { var canvas = document.getElementById("canvas"); var obj = canvas.getContext('2d ...
在2D游戏中,类似泡泡龙炮台发射、敌人飞机永远指向PLAYER、愤怒小鸟弹弓发射等效果,都需要用到物体跟随鼠标绕一个点旋转的效果,在unity中实现代码很简单,但是在理解上有一定障碍,因为unity是3D界面,他的旋转并不是2D世界中那么简单。 实现这种效果,可以使用两种方法,一种是采用 ...
2019-01-23 19:57:38 挂一个比较简单的一个canvas应用,利用CPU进行粒子实时计算,直接面向过程写的 帧动画:浏览器在下一个动画帧安排一次网页重绘, requestAnimationFrame 是由浏览器专门为动画提供的API,在运行时浏览器会自动优化方法的调用 ...
: 1.确认跟随鼠标的是一个div。 在javascrip ...
1.这篇为最基础的鼠标点击,移动生成一个随意方向的箭头,日后再把复杂的效果补上; 2.涉及到canvas,面向对象,一些数学角度运算,当然还有jq; 3.content: 首先canvas声明 var canvas=document.getElementById('canvas ...
本篇文档记录绘制心电图之后,通过鼠标点击,绘制出一条线,同时鼠标旁边浮动出来字符长度。 想了解心电图的同学可以查看我之前的技术文档,里面有完整的代码, 但看此篇文档看懂之后可以理解如何通过鼠标点击拖拽就能画出图形,以及如何让标签跟着鼠标移动。 首先,我们在HTML页新建一个canvas标签 ...
鼠标跟随,顾名思义,就是在鼠标移动的时候,有个动画跟随着鼠标一起移动。 要点一:var oEvent = evt || window.event; 这个是为了兼容ie和ff而写的,在ie下window.event表示event对象,而ff下,是给事件函数传一个参数,这个参数就表示事件对象 ...
通过事件对象属性e.clientX / e.clientY(鼠标距离浏览器窗口左上角的距离),实现图片随鼠标一起移动的功能~ ...